Your ambient memory for Claude
Minimi is an innovative ambient memory tool designed to enhance the way users interact with Claude, an advanced AI language model. By seamlessly listening across a Mac—covering documents, calls, messages, and browser tabs—it provides a comprehensive contextual backdrop for more accurate and relevant AI responses. Unlike traditional prompt-based interactions, Minimi automates the process of feeding context to Claude, making AI assistance more natural and efficient. Its on-device operation ensures user privacy and data security, appealing to professionals and power users who prioritize confidentiality. Minimi is ideal for those looking to streamline workflows, improve information recall, and maximize the potential of AI without manual prompt management.

Batch-recolor 500+ sprites in seconds
ColorCraft is a powerful batch-recoloring engine designed specifically for pixel artists and game developers. It streamlines the often tedious process of creating multiple character, elemental, or biome variants by automating color adjustments across large sets of sprites. With its native Aseprite Live-Link and four perceptual color matching algorithms, ColorCraft allows users to update hundreds of sprites in real-time with minimal effort, significantly speeding up asset generation workflows. Its industrial-scale batching capability enables recoloring of over 500 sprites within seconds, making it an ideal tool for projects that require rapid iteration and consistency across assets. Whether you're working on a fantasy RPG, a platformer, or a biome-themed game, ColorCraft helps artists quickly produce diverse visual variations while maintaining artistic coherence, freeing up more time for creative tasks.
